With regards to Raspberry Pi initiatives, it’s arduous to beat the artistic spark that comes with every vacation season. At this time we’ve acquired an thrilling Pi-powered Christmas venture to indicate off from maker Zatagado. With the assistance of our favourite SBC, Zatagado is ready to management the lights on their Christmas tree utilizing a customized net server.
The venture is constructed round a Raspberry Pi 4 however you might simply recreate the idea utilizing a Pi 3 or perhaps a Pi Zero W. The Pi must have GPIO to regulate the Christmas lights, which on this case is a strip of individually addressable WS2812b LEDs, in addition to an Web connection to assist host the net server interface.
The Pi is linked to the LED strip and is able to controlling it with customized results. These sequences are saved on the Pi and will be accessed from any gadget with an online browser, due to a server that runs on the Pi. Customers can connect with the net interface and choose completely different mild animations to regulate the consequences in actual time.
Of their Reddit thread (opens in new tab), Zatagado goes on to elucidate how the net interface goes collectively, backed up with expertise from CS programs they studied in faculty. It depends on Flask for the again finish and makes use of React to create the front-end interface.
Based on Zatagado, plans are already within the works to spruce up the venture for subsequent 12 months with extra options. Upgrades embody issues like the flexibility to select colours in addition to altering the strips out for extra conventional string lights.